Robert Hope Gillespie was born in 1892 in Anderson, Anderson, South Carolina, USA, the child of Robert Winfield Bob Gillespie And Mary Louvenia Walker. In 1900, Robert Hope Gillespie resided in Garvin, Anderson, South Carolina, USA. In 1910, Robert Hope Gillespie resided in Pickens, South Carolina, USA. Robert Hope Gillespie married Amanda Watkins, Elizabeth S Lizzie Smith, and had children including Frances Elizabeth Lib Gillespie Mcalister Bruce, Hamilton Fredrick Gillespie, Lillian Margaret Gillespie Elliott Baldwin, Roy Holder Gillespie. Robert Hope Gillespie passed away in 1939 in Anderson County, South Carolina, United States of America.
